Home
last modified time | relevance | path

Searched refs:kernel_neon_end (Results 1 – 25 of 37) sorted by relevance

12

/Linux-v4.19/lib/raid6/
Dneon.c17 #define kernel_neon_end() macro
41 kernel_neon_end(); \
52 kernel_neon_end(); \
Drecov_neon.c17 #define kernel_neon_end() macro
70 kernel_neon_end(); in raid6_2data_recov_neon()
101 kernel_neon_end(); in raid6_datap_recov_neon()
/Linux-v4.19/arch/arm64/crypto/
Dsm3-ce-glue.c36 kernel_neon_end(); in sm3_ce_update()
48 kernel_neon_end(); in sm3_ce_final()
61 kernel_neon_end(); in sm3_ce_finup()
Dsha1-ce-glue.c48 kernel_neon_end(); in sha1_ce_update()
73 kernel_neon_end(); in sha1_ce_finup()
87 kernel_neon_end(); in sha1_ce_final()
Dsha512-ce-glue.c41 kernel_neon_end(); in sha512_ce_update()
62 kernel_neon_end(); in sha512_ce_finup()
76 kernel_neon_end(); in sha512_ce_final()
Daes-neonbs-glue.c88 kernel_neon_end(); in aesbs_setkey()
114 kernel_neon_end(); in __ecb_crypt()
149 kernel_neon_end(); in aesbs_cbc_setkey()
171 kernel_neon_end(); in cbc_encrypt()
197 kernel_neon_end(); in cbc_decrypt()
219 kernel_neon_end(); in aesbs_ctr_setkey_sync()
247 kernel_neon_end(); in ctr_encrypt()
310 kernel_neon_end(); in __xts_crypt()
322 kernel_neon_end(); in __xts_crypt()
Dsha2-ce-glue.c53 kernel_neon_end(); in sha256_ce_update()
85 kernel_neon_end(); in sha256_ce_finup()
102 kernel_neon_end(); in sha256_ce_final()
Daes-glue.c146 kernel_neon_end(); in ecb_encrypt()
166 kernel_neon_end(); in ecb_decrypt()
186 kernel_neon_end(); in cbc_encrypt()
206 kernel_neon_end(); in cbc_decrypt()
226 kernel_neon_end(); in ctr_encrypt()
243 kernel_neon_end(); in ctr_encrypt()
277 kernel_neon_end(); in xts_encrypt()
299 kernel_neon_end(); in xts_decrypt()
426 kernel_neon_end(); in cmac_setkey()
456 kernel_neon_end(); in xcbc_setkey()
[all …]
Dsm4-ce-glue.c28 kernel_neon_end(); in sm4_ce_encrypt()
41 kernel_neon_end(); in sm4_ce_decrypt()
Dsha3-ce-glue.c47 kernel_neon_end(); in sha3_update()
60 kernel_neon_end(); in sha3_update()
88 kernel_neon_end(); in sha3_final()
Daes-ce-glue.c62 kernel_neon_end(); in aes_cipher_encrypt()
76 kernel_neon_end(); in aes_cipher_decrypt()
142 kernel_neon_end(); in ce_aes_expandkey()
Daes-ce-ccm-glue.c116 kernel_neon_end(); in ccm_update_mac()
272 kernel_neon_end(); in ccm_encrypt()
280 kernel_neon_end(); in ccm_encrypt()
330 kernel_neon_end(); in ccm_decrypt()
338 kernel_neon_end(); in ccm_decrypt()
Dchacha20-neon-glue.c42 kernel_neon_end(); in chacha20_doneon()
65 kernel_neon_end(); in chacha20_doneon()
Dsha256-glue.c112 kernel_neon_end(); in sha256_update_neon()
134 kernel_neon_end(); in sha256_finup_neon()
/Linux-v4.19/arch/arm/include/asm/
Dxor.h159 kernel_neon_end(); in xor_neon_2()
172 kernel_neon_end(); in xor_neon_3()
185 kernel_neon_end(); in xor_neon_4()
198 kernel_neon_end(); in xor_neon_5()
Dneon.h36 void kernel_neon_end(void);
/Linux-v4.19/arch/arm/crypto/
Daes-ce-glue.c133 kernel_neon_end(); in ce_aes_expandkey()
193 kernel_neon_end(); in ecb_encrypt()
213 kernel_neon_end(); in ecb_decrypt()
234 kernel_neon_end(); in cbc_encrypt()
255 kernel_neon_end(); in cbc_decrypt()
291 kernel_neon_end(); in ctr_encrypt()
313 kernel_neon_end(); in xts_encrypt()
335 kernel_neon_end(); in xts_decrypt()
Dsha1_neon_glue.c49 kernel_neon_end(); in sha1_neon_update()
65 kernel_neon_end(); in sha1_neon_finup()
Dsha1-ce-glue.c42 kernel_neon_end(); in sha1_ce_update()
57 kernel_neon_end(); in sha1_ce_finup()
Dsha512-neon-glue.c40 kernel_neon_end(); in sha512_neon_update()
57 kernel_neon_end(); in sha512_neon_finup()
Dsha256_neon_glue.c44 kernel_neon_end(); in sha256_update()
61 kernel_neon_end(); in sha256_finup()
Daes-neonbs-glue.c75 kernel_neon_end(); in aesbs_setkey()
104 kernel_neon_end(); in __ecb_crypt()
134 kernel_neon_end(); in aesbs_cbc_setkey()
174 kernel_neon_end(); in cbc_decrypt()
232 kernel_neon_end(); in ctr_encrypt()
297 kernel_neon_end(); in __xts_crypt()
Dsha2-ce-glue.c44 kernel_neon_end(); in sha2_ce_update()
60 kernel_neon_end(); in sha2_ce_finup()
/Linux-v4.19/Documentation/arm/
Dkernel_mode_neon.txt10 * Put kernel_neon_begin() and kernel_neon_end() calls around the calls into your
45 function kernel_neon_end().
60 kernel_neon_end() and kernel_neon_begin() in places in your code where none of
81 kernel_neon_end(), i.e., that it is only allowed to issue NEON/VFP instructions
91 * issue the calls to kernel_neon_begin(), kernel_neon_end() as well as the calls
/Linux-v4.19/arch/arm64/include/asm/
Dneon.h20 void kernel_neon_end(void);

12